Walker Opens Conference with Hurricane Updates, ENERGY STAR® and More

Rich Walker, president of the association, opened the general session of the American Architectural Manufacturers Association's (AAMA) fall meeting with several updates, including one on the Precipitation Imaging Probe for which AAMA has been providing funding to assist in the study of hurricanes. The device was deployed during both of the most recent hurricanes, Ike and Hannah.

"They hope to start getting some good data from that," he said.

Walker also warned attendees to provide feedback on the revised ENERGY STAR® draft criteria so it can be presented in comment form by AAMA before the October deadline (CLICK HERE for more on that deadline).

One popular topic throughout the conference was the group's green certification program, which currently is under development. Walker advised he has meetings planned with both the U.S. Green Building Council and the Green Building Initiative in order to get feedback on the AAMA program as it develops.

"We don't want to go too far down our road without having their input," he said.
